The completion of CP’s renovation last year brought back the much required buzz at this iconic marketplace. Shoppers started coming back and new restaurants too started opening up. Over the last 18 months, more than two dozen new restaurants have come up in CP & its surroundings.

One such launch was of the Zamozza World Kitchen & Bar in the month of March. Started by the first generation restaurateur Vidur Kanodia, who also bought Mumbai’s fame Shiv Sagar in Delhi, it is a multi-cuisine restaurant located on the Janpath road besides Shiv Sagar. The narrow entrance is the most dramatic with multiple reflective mirrors on the walls, light bulbs covered ceiling, and monochromatic tiled flooring leading to a yellow door which opens up to the hall-type restaurant. The high ceiling gives it a roomy feel and the yellow & white interior was simple yet elegant.
Litchi Wontons: sprinkled with herbs & bean sprouts. They were fresh, crispy and had a tantalizing aroma.
